Kiley Juergens Wealth Management LLC Takes Position in Advanced Micro Devices, Inc. $AMD

Kiley Juergens Wealth Management LLC acquired a new position in shares of Advanced Micro Devices, Inc. (NASDAQ:AMDFree Report) during the first quarter, Holdings Channel reports. The fund acquired 5,726 shares of the semiconductor manufacturer’s stock, valued at approximately $1,165,000.

Advanced Micro Devices Stock Down 8.2%

Advanced Micro Devices stock traded down $45.30 during midday trading on Tuesday, hitting $506.75. 11,040,379 shares of the stock were exchanged, compared to its average volume of 37,292,695. Advanced Micro Devices, Inc. has a 52-week low of $135.91 and a 52-week high of $584.73. The company has a quick ratio of 1.96, a current ratio of 2.72 and a debt-to-equity ratio of 0.04. The business’s 50-day moving average price is $470.75 and its 200-day moving average price is $308.01. The stock has a market capitalization of $826.30 billion, a price-to-earnings ratio of 166.24, a price-to-earnings-growth ratio of 1.53 and a beta of 2.47.

Advanced Micro Devices (NASDAQ:AMDGet Free Report) last posted its quarterly earnings data on Tuesday, May 5th. The semiconductor manufacturer reported $1.37 EPS for the quarter, beating the consensus estimate of $1.29 by $0.08. Advanced Micro Devices had a net margin of 13.37% and a return on equity of 9.55%. The firm had revenue of $10.25 billion during the quarter, compared to analyst estimates of $9.90 billion. During the same quarter last year, the business posted $0.96 EPS. The company’s revenue for the quarter was up 37.8% on a year-over-year basis. On average, research analysts expect that Advanced Micro Devices, Inc. will post 6.15 EPS for the current fiscal year.

Advanced Micro Devices Company Profile

(Free Report)

Advanced Micro Devices, Inc (NASDAQ: AMD) is a global semiconductor company that designs and sells microprocessors, graphics processors, chipsets and adaptive computing solutions for a broad set of markets. The company’s product portfolio includes consumer and commercial CPUs under the Ryzen and Threadripper brands, data center processors under the EPYC brand, and Radeon graphics processing units for gaming and professional visualization. AMD also offers semi-custom system-on-chip (SoC) products for gaming consoles and other specialized applications, and provides supporting software and platform technologies for OEMs, cloud service providers and end users.

Founded in 1969, AMD has evolved from a supplier of logic chips into a diversified, fabless semiconductor designer.
